How Does AI Art Generator Work?

Author: Steve

Sep. 09, 2024

1. Understanding AI Art Generators

AI art generators are applications powered by artificial intelligence that create visual artwork from text prompts or images. These systems leverage machine learning techniques to produce unique pieces of art, blending creativity with technology. Here’s a deeper look at how these fascinating tools work.

2. Key Components of AI Art Generators

AI art generators typically consist of several key components:

  1. Data Collection: To create art, AI systems require a large dataset of existing artwork. This dataset includes various art styles, techniques, and historical artists to train the AI on different artistic features.
  2. Machine Learning Models: Most AI art generators use models like Generative Adversarial Networks (GANs) or diffusion models. These models help the AI understand how to generate images that resemble the training data.
  3. Text Input Processing: Many generators allow users to provide text prompts describing what they want to create. Natural Language Processing (NLP) techniques help the AI interpret these instructions accurately.
  4. Feedback and Refinement: The machine generates images based on the input and then uses feedback loops to refine the output, improving its quality and alignment with user expectations.

3. The Process of Creating Art

The art creation process involves several clear steps:

  1. User Input: The user enters a prompt describing the desired artwork. For instance, "a serene landscape with mountains at sunset."
  2. Text Analysis: The AI analyzes the text using NLP algorithms to understand the themes, colors, and styles mentioned in the prompt.
  3. Image Generation: The AI then generates several initial images based on the analyzed input. This is where models like GANs come into play, creating outputs that blend learned artistic styles.
  4. Iteration: The system might go through several iterations of refining the artwork based on both the user’s feedback and internal assessments of image quality.
  5. Final Output: Once satisfied with the generated piece, the AI provides the final artwork to the user, ready for download or further editing.

4. Applications of AI Art Generators

AI art generators have various applications, including:

  1. Personalized Artwork: Users can create custom art pieces tailored to personal preferences or space decor needs.
  2. Content Creation: Designers and marketers can utilize AI-generated art for digital content, websites, and social media graphics.
  3. Art Exploration: Artists can explore new styles and ideas, using AI as a collaborative tool to push their creative boundaries.
  4. Accessibility: These tools open up art creation to individuals without traditional artistic skills, promoting creativity across diverse populations.

5. The Future of AI Art Generators

As technology continues to evolve, AI art generators will likely improve in quality and creativity. Future advancements may allow for even more nuanced input processing and higher fidelity in artwork creation, further merging technology with artistic expression.
